Marc Glogovsky, MS
He has been an active PDA member for over 25 years and is presently serving on the Board of Directors and the PDA/FDA Joint Regulatory Conference planning committee for the past few years. Additionally, Marc has co-chaired several Technical Reports and Points to Consider publications and served on the Education, Science and ATMP Advisory Boards.
In 2020, Marc was the recipient of the James P. Agalloco award for his efforts at PDA’s Training and Research Institute, the 2022 Michael Korczynski Award for his support of PDA’s international activities and a Service Appreciation Award in 2023 for his time spent as the Microbiology/EM Interest Group co-lead.
Marc earned his B.S. in Biology from Monmouth University and his M.S. in Microbiology & Molecular Genetics from Rutgers University.
